Horror Film Review By Matt Boiselle – SEQUEL: CRUEL SUMMER PART II Directed By Scott Tepperman

tbm horror - horror book review - CRUEL SUMMER PART II Directed By Scott Tepperman

Starring: ASHLYN MCCAIN, BRIDGET LINDA FROEMMING, SCOTT TEPPERMAN

Just exactly how would one repeat the bloodshed & unflinching carnage of an Estival Solstice film, strictly in the hopes of bringing back an audience to howl at the gore? Well, the answer is quite simple: you deposit a nice chunk of the original cast back into the horror stew, and you lock the kitchen doors as the maniacal chefs responsible conduct a killer cookin’ session! Awww…did I leave ya in the dark on that one? Have no fear, ya lunatics, cause it’s time for SEQUEL: CRUEL SUMMER PART II – hope you’ve got some decent stain remover handy as this crimson’s sure to wreck your church duds.

Presented by Los Bastardz Productions (comprised of Scott Tepperman & Jim O’Rear), this second-venture into seasonal wickedness continues the story after the first film, and its traumatized band of survivors. Apparently the best way to combat the nightmarish incident they suffered through is to present a stage production of the events, essentially reopening the same damaging wounds once again. Little do they know is that the first film’s masked (and at times unmasked) butcher, Gunnar (played by Tepperman alongside his writing/directorial duties) is making his way back, and is vowing to clean up the remainder of the mess that was previously left behind. I’ve gotta tell ya – I guess a stage production consisting of your mental triggers is more efficient in psyche-healing than say…a year’s worth of psychotherapy?

In any event, not much time passes before our theater-troupe is being hunted down by the malicious fella in the sinister disguise, and with a heavy dosage of practical FX, the kills are sadistic, sanguine and pretty damned satisfying. With returning performances from Ashlyn McCain, Bridget Linda Froemming & Will Horton (just to name a few), the movie definitely takes on a reunion-atmosphere, and what truly seems like a lost display in a lot of films these days, this cast simply looks to be having the time of their lives when in front of the cameras. While we’re on the subject of camera work, GOLD-STAR for the usage of some very panoramic drone shots here – nice touch, cinematically.

At the end of the day when all the blood has been hosed off of the slab, Tepperman’s CRUEL SUMMER PART II is a worthy-addition that (hopefully) will have another installment coming down the pipe in the future. This is a film made by people who are lovers of the genre, and while some might decry “low-budget” indie-horror, I say we as fans should revel in it – these are passion-projects and quite frankly the stuff that keeps the industry truckin’ along. Thanks to Scott Tepperman & Jim O’Rear for offering this up, and keep in mind that both movies are slated to be released months apart in 2023 by Scream Team Releasing and will be available through streaming services, as well as on DVD, Blu-ray & VHS formats.
